The construction of the Karanganyar Regency Public Service Mall project is
on Jl. Karanganyar-Jumantono, Ngaliyan Environment, Lalung District, Karanganyar Regency. The structure of the Public Service Mall project consists of
a 1st floor structure and a 2nd floor structure. The construction of the Karanganyar
Regency Public Service Mall project which has 2 floors has been established on an
area of 4,489 m2 with a building area of 1,016 m2. In the development process on
a project is made based on a plan. Planning is intended so that construction project
activities can be carried out properly and on time. The Budget Plan (RAB) is a
calculation of the amount of costs required for materials and wages, as well as
other costs related to the implementation of the building or project.
The research in this final project is a case study, which is to calculate the
comparison of prices and percentages in the analysis of the budget plan for the
construction project of the Karanganyar Regency Public Service Mall. The data
collection method used in this final project is secondary data, namely by obtaining
data on the prices of workers' wages and materials/materials from the Contractor
and also from the SNI Guidelines.
The process of calculating the estimated cost of the structure budget in the
construction project of the Karanganyar Regency Public Service Mall using several
methods, the results of the calculation using the SNI method obtained a result of
Rp. 2,591,995,366.32 while the results of the estimation of the cost budget by the
contractor calculation method obtained the results of Rp. 2,485,185,566,13. In
order to obtain a comparison of the estimated cost budget between the SNI method
and the contractor's calculation, the SNI method is 4% more expensive than the
contractor's calculation method. Based on the calculation of the estimated cost of
the two methods, the estimation results using the Contractor's calculation method
are the most economical.
